Corporate Governance & Ethical Sourcing Roles (UK) Description
Senior Corporate Governance Officer Develops and implements corporate governance frameworks, ensuring compliance with regulations and best practices in ethical sourcing. Oversees risk management strategies. High demand.
Ethical Sourcing Manager Manages the entire ethical sourcing process, from supplier selection and due diligence to monitoring and reporting on ethical performance. Key role for responsible businesses.
Sustainability Consultant (Corporate Governance Focus) Advises organizations on integrating corporate governance and ethical sourcing into their sustainability strategies, driving positive social and environmental impact. Growing field.
Compliance & Ethics Officer Ensures adherence to all relevant laws and regulations, including those related to ethical sourcing and corporate governance. Crucial for maintaining organizational integrity.
